Exapace Gel is a combination of medicines used to treat long-lasting (chronic) pain caused by nerve damage due to diabetes, shingles or spinal cord injury. It reduces pain and its associated symptoms such as mood changes, sleep problems, and tiredness. Gabapentin, an active ingredient of this medicine, is thought to work by interfering with pain signals that travel through the damaged nerves and the brain.

How to use Exapace Gel
This medicine is for external use only. Use it in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. Check the label for directions before use. Clean and dry the affected area and apply the gel. Wash your hands after applying, unless hands are the affected area.
How Exapace Gel works
Exapace Gel is a combination of two medicines: Gabapentin and Lidocaine. Gabapentin is an alpha 2 delta ligand which decreases pain by modulating calcium channel activity of the nerve cells. Lidocaine is a local anesthetic which works by blocking pain signals from the nerves to brain thereby decreasing the sensation of pain. Together, they relieve neuropathic pain (pain from damaged nerves).

Pregnancy
CON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The safety of Exapace Gel during pregnancy has not been established. There are no adequate and well-controlled studies in pregnant women, and animal data on reproductive toxicity are insufficient. Your doctor will weigh the benefits and any potential risks before prescribing.
Breast feeding
SA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Exapace Gel may be safe to use during breastfeeding. Animal studies have shown low or no adverse effects to the developing baby; however, there are limited human studies.

What if you forget to take Exapace Gel?
If you miss a dose of Exapace Gel, apply it as soon as possible. However, if it is almost time for your next dose, skip the missed dose and go back to your regular schedule. Do not double the dose.

What serious allergic reactions could Exapace Gel cause?
Rare but severe allergic reactions to Exapace Gel may include rash, swelling, redness, persistent itching, difficulty breathing, or numbness spreading away from the area. Seek urgent medical help if these occur.
Can Exapace Gel be used by children or older adults?
Exapace Gel is typically meant for adults aged 18 years and older. For older adults, start with a small quantity to minimize any increased sensitivity or risk.
What symptoms mean I should stop using Exapace Gel and see a doctor?
Unexplained severe rash, swelling, burning, persistent skin ulcers, or trouble breathing after using Exapace Gel require immediate medical attention.
Are there risks if Exapace Gel is used for too long or on a large skin area?
Long-term or high-quantity use of Exapace Gel on large body areas may increase the risk of toxicity or severe reactions. Follow your doctor’s advice on dosage and application areas.
Should I avoid covering the Exapace Gel-treated area with a bandage?
Unless your doctor advises otherwise, avoid wrapping or bandaging the area after Exapace Gel application, as this may increase absorption and side effects.
What are the warning signs of nerve damage from using Exapace Gel?
If you experience severe numbness, tingling far from the treated area, or weakness, stop using Exapace Gel and contact your doctor.
